Ian Pollard: TUI Benefits From Hot European Summer
TUI AG TUI updates that the year to the 30th September will be the fourth consecutive year of double digit growth in underlying EBITA and unlike Thomas Cook it claims to have benefited from the sustained period of hot weather in Northern Europe which produced further growth The only impact of the hot weather was […]

Corporate news review Tuesday 26th September 2017
AA Plc AA. Reports a robust H1 for Roadside and Insurance. Trading EBITDA rose 1% to £193m reflecting gains in insurance broking as well as reduced Head Office costs.
